Due to our coastal climate and frequent stop-and-go traffic on 23rd Street and the Hathaway Bridge, common issues include CVT transmission service or repair on models like the Altima and Rogue, brake corrosion from salt air, and air conditioning system strain. Regular maintenance to combat humidity and road salt is especially important for local Nissan owners.

Typically, yes, dealership labor rates are higher. However, for major warranty work or complex computer reprogramming, the dealership's specific tools and training may be necessary. For most routine repairs and maintenance, a trusted independent shop in Lynn Haven can provide significant savings with comparable quality.
Seek immediate service for warning lights like the check engine or brake light, unusual CVT transmission behavior (hesitation, jerking), or overheating, especially before long drives on Highway 77 or during our hot summer months. Ignoring these can lead to more extensive and costly damage.
The high humidity and salt air accelerate corrosion and mold growth in ventilation systems. It's advisable to have more frequent brake inspections, undercarriage checks for rust, and cabin air filter changes. Preparing your Nissan for the intense summer heat and occasional heavy rains is also crucial for reliability.
